Movies of Robert Carson and Frank J. Scannell together
Robert Carson and Frank J. Scannell have starred in 5 movies together. Their first film was My Dream Is Yours in 1949. The most recent movie that Robert Carson and Frank J. Scannell starred together was Too Much, Too Soon in 1958.
